On-the-Go PassFollowing last year's introduction of our On-the-Go Pass - an economical way to enjoy a one-time visit to key Riverwalk attractions - the Naperville Park District is bringing it back for 2009. Additionally, it is expanding the program to offer a 'Plus' version of the pass, which includes one-time admission to DuPage Children's Museum and Naper Settlement.

New Open Space and Recreation Master Plan

New Open Space and Recreation Master Plan - 
At the July 10, 2008 Park Board meeting, the Commissioners approved the Park District's newest Open Space and Recreation Master Plan. This document provides an in-depth view of the District's resources, programs and services, and outlines the benefits of enhanced community partnerships to establish equitability across the District.
